Hi Frank and everyone:

I know that it has been over two years as of this posting; however, I am also a new California Licensed Agent.  Thus, these postings were very helpful to me.  It sure clears up a few questions.  Anyone in California that can answer additional questions on this topic regarding wholesaling and referral fees.  I think many mistake wholesaling as doing something wrong, unfair or illegal; however, it is not.  Every thing we consume or purchase starts with a wholesaler.  A wholesale means that the distressed property is sold for what it is worth and then when it is brought up to standards then it is valued at the retail price.  Therefore, everyone is getting paid for what the property is worth and the investor for the work performed.  As an inactive CPA I can tell you that this is commerce, and homes is a product.  I know that the subject is touchier, but the rules of commerce still apply, with other specific rules for Real Estate.  I hope this helps.

I would also like to know if referral fees are illegal to an agent from an investor.
